cryptlib 3.0
Cryptlib by Peter Gutmann is a security toolkit that allows even less experienced programmers to add strong encryption and authentication services to their programs, security features that are becoming more and more indispensable.
|
Cryptlib by Peter Gutmann is a security toolkit that allows even less experienced programmers to add strong encryption and authentication services to their programs, security features that are becoming more and more indispensable.
The library attempts to hide the low-level details of encryption/decryption and authentication from programmers, allowing them to quickly make their projects more secure.
Some of the symmetric encryption (private key) and authentication algorithms that cryptlib supports include the following:
The following hash algorithms are available in the library:
It offers services such as:
It features various hashed message authentication code algorithms:
Finally, asymmetric (public/private key) encryption algorithms such as the following are available:
cryptlib can also be used with a variety of crypto devices (for example, Fortezza cards and Smart cards).
cryptlib contains as core components implementations of the most popular encryption and authentication algorithms, AES, Blowfish, CAST, DES, triple DES, IDEA, RC2, RC4, RC5, and Skipjack conventional encryption, MD2, MD4, MD5, RIPEMD-160 and SHA hash algorithms, HMAC-MD5, HMAC-SHA, and HMAC-RIPEMD-160 MAC algorithms, and Diffie-Hellman, DSA, Elgamal, and RSA public-key encryption.
In addition to these built-in capabilities, cryptlib can make use of the crypto capabilities of a variety of external crypto devices such as hardware security modules (HSMs), Fortezza cards, PKCS #11 devices, and crypto smart cards. The crypto device interface also provides a convenient general-purpose plug-in capability for adding new functionality which will be automatically used by cryptlib.
The library is free if used in personal, freeware, or shareware projects. The library is written in C. ActiveX and C++ wrappers are provided. The project is OSI Certified Open Source Software.
tags
the library ripemd 160 and authentication the following diffie hellman key encryption hmac ripemd hellman dsa hmac sha cryptlib can the crypto smart cards fortezza cards

Download cryptlib 3.0
Authors software
cryptlib 3.0
Peter Gutmann
Cryptlib by Peter Gutmann is a security toolkit that allows even less experienced programmers to add strong encryption and authentication services to their programs, security features that are becoming more and more indispensable.
Similar software
cryptlib 3.0
Peter Gutmann
Cryptlib by Peter Gutmann is a security toolkit that allows even less experienced programmers to add strong encryption and authentication services to their programs, security features that are becoming more and more indispensable.
Programmers ToolKit 1.0
CSD Computer Services
Programmers ToolKit is a free program used to organize programming projects.
iSafeguard Freeware 6.1.1
MXC Software
iSafeguard is a free and powerful cryptographic application which enables you to protect your most valuable assets - information with strong encryption and authentication.
BT AES File Encrypt 1.0
Bowers Technologies
BT AES File Encrypt is a utility used to encrypt files with strong AES encryption.
BioCert Biometric Authenticator Lite 1.0
Biometrics Direct
Our standard software programming toolkit can offer 1:m matching capability up to 10 users.
CompuSec PC Security Suite 4.21 SP2
CE-Infosys Pte Ltd
CompuSec is a security software designed to protect desktops and notebooks.
MezerTools 1.9.5.1
Bayden Systems
MezerTools is a simple toolkit for UI designers & programmers.
Atol 0.3.7
Miroslav Rajcic
Atol is a dual panel file manager written using GTK+ toolkit and C++ programming language.
MaxCrypt 2.0.1.0
KinoCode, Inc
MaxCrypt offers you an automated computer encryption application that protects your PC
MaxCrypt Security Suite is the premiere solution for computer security.
Password Safe 3.0
Password Safe Company Ltd
Password Safe keeps your passwords and data secure with 256-bit encryption.
Other software in this category
AMRandom 4.3
ESB Consultancy
This aims to supply a Borland Delphi translation of Alan Miller`s Random Module for FORTRAN-90.
FreeSMTP.Net 1.0
Quiksoft Corporation
FreeSMTP.
Redcoal Mobile Internet Developer API (MIDA) 5.0
Redcoal
Enable your web sites, intranets or applications to send and receive SMS messages to and from 130 countries.
ReportLab PDF Library 1.17
Dinu Gherman
ReportLab PDF Library - Package for high-quality dynamic personalized PDF documents in real-time & high volumes from any data sources.
VB6 Setup Program with Skin 1.2
visual-basic.com.ar
You can change your default VB6 setup program with this improved setup program: VB6 Setup Program with Skin.